Information

 

1. Before using the mortar mixer, it must be checked and accepted by the construction safety management department to confirm that the mortar mixer meets the requirements, and it can be used only after it is issued a permit or has an acceptance procedure. The installation should be stable and firm.

  2. The temporary construction electricity should be protected and connected to zero, equipped with a leakage protector, and equipped with three-level power distribution and two-pole protection. Generally, the mixer is one-way rotating for mixing. Therefore, when connecting to the power supply, pay attention to the direction of the mixer drum to match the direction of the arrow on the mixer drum.

  3. Before starting up, check whether the insulation and grounding of electrical equipment are good (such as when using protective grounding) and whether the belt pulley protective cover is complete.

  4. After starting, first go through idling to check the rotation direction of the mixing blade is correct, and then add water while adding material for mixing operation.

  5. When feeding the mortar mixer, it is not allowed to step on it or use a shovel or wooden stick to pull down or scrape the mouth of the mixing barrel. The tool cannot collide with the mixing blade, let alone stick the tool into the hopper when rotating. People are not allowed to stand under the hopper of the mixer. Safety hooks must be hung up when the hopper is started and stopped.

   6. Do not use hands or wooden sticks to reach into the mixing drum or clean the ash paddle at the mouth of the drum during operation.

  7. If there is a failure during operation, the power should be cut off, the mortar in the cylinder should be poured out, and the failure should be eliminated.

   8. After the operation, the inside and outside of the mortar mixer should be cleaned, maintained, and the site cleaned, cut off the power supply, and lock the door
